Is an 87 bed the same as a 77 bed?

Thinking about chopping my 77 lwb down to a swb and I have access to an 87 bed for free. Do they have the same body lines? The 87 is about an hour from me and I can't get there until this weekend so I thought I'd ask here and see if anyone knew. I tried to search first but came up empty handed.

Re: Is an 87 bed the same as a 77 bed?

Yes the bed will swap to your swb the only thing that is different is on the 80's bed it'll have gas cap covers that's really the only difference.

Re: Is an 87 bed the same as a 77 bed?

Gas doors. Tailgate hardware. The bump in the floor for the fill hose.
But will bolt in place.
I have 85 quarters on a 73 floor.

Re: Is an 87 bed the same as a 77 bed?

Agree with the above, but would add the single tank on the 77 will be on the right side, and the single tank on the 87 will be on the left side.

If either (or both) had dual tanks then it's no issue.
